Hardwood Flooring Redecorating 101: The Process Overview

Step 1: Collect Your Tools

Before diving right into redecorating, guarantee you have all needed devices available:

|Tool|Purpose|| ---------------|--------------------------------------|| Sander|To remove old coating|| Vacuum cleaner|For cleansing dust|| Stain|To boost color|| End up Layer|To secure the wood|

Step 2: Prepare Your Space

Clear out furnishings and cover vents to reduce dust spread during fining sand. Ample air flow is crucial!

Step 3: Sanding Your Floors

Sanding is just one of one of the most essential steps in the refinishing process:

Start with coarse-grit sandpaper (around 36 grit). Move on medium (60 grit) after that great grit (100 grit). Ensure also insurance coverage; an orbital sander works best for beginners.

Step 4: Cleansing Dirt Residue

After sanding, vacuum cleaner completely and clean down surfaces with a wet cloth to remove all dust particles-- this action is essential for making sure a smooth finish application.

Choosing the Right Stain for Your Wood Floors

Stain Types Available

When selecting a stain, take into consideration:

    Oil-Based Stains Provide rich shades yet take longer to dry. Water-Based Stains Quick-drying with less smell yet supply much less depth in color.

Testing Stain Colors Before Application

Always test discolorations on a surprise location first! This helps visualize just how different shades connect with your timber type.

Applying End up Coats Successfully

Types of Finishes Available

Different surfaces deal with numerous needs:

    Polyurethane Offers superb security; readily available in water-based or oil-based versions. Varnish Provides great longevity yet takes longer to dry contrasted to polyurethane.

Application Methods for Best Results

Use a premium brush or roller. Apply slim coats; too thick bring about gurgling or peeling. Follow manufacturer instructions regarding drying times between coats-- patience pays off!
